The Official Step-by-Step Process to Get a Polish Driving License
Getting a driving license legally in Poland needs perseverance, study, and commitment. Below is the basic roadmap for getting a Category B (standard cars and truck) license.
Step 1: Obtain a PKK Number (Profil Kandydata na Kierowcę)
Before starting driving lessons, a candidate must protect a Candidate Driver Profile (Profil Kandydata na Kierowcę or PKK).
- Where to go: The local district workplace (Urząd Dzielnicy or Starostwo Powiatowe).
- Required documents:
- Completed application kind.
- A legitimate ID (passport or house card).
- A recent passport-sized photo (3.5 x 4.5 cm).
- A medical certificate confirming fitness to drive.
- Confirmation of legal residence in Poland (minimum 185 days).
Step 2: Complete State-Approved Training
Once the PKK number is released, the applicant should register in a state-certified driving school (Ośrodek Szkolenia KierowcóDostawa prawa jazdy w Polsce - OSK).
- Theory: Usually consists of around 30 hours of classroom direction (lots of schools offer English-language courses).
- Practice: A minimum of 30 hours behind-the-wheel training with a licensed instructor.
Step 3: Pass the State Exams
After finishing the driving school curriculum, the candidate needs to pass two state evaluations administered by the Provincial Road Traffic Center (Wojewódzki Ośrodek Ruchu Drogowego - WORD).

Upon passing both examinations, the WORD center updates the digital system. The candidate should then go back to their regional district office to pay the administrative cost for the physical card issuance (approximately 100 PLN). The plastic license is typically ready within 2 to 3 weeks.

Yes, Poland allows both EU and non-EU people to acquire a driving license, provided they meet specific residency requirements.
- EU/EEA Citizens: Can exchange their home country license for a Polish one or drive using their existing EU license till it expires.
- Non-EU Citizens: Must prove legal residency in Poland for a minimum of 185 days per fiscal year. 2. How much does it cost to get a driving license lawfully in Poland?
The overall expense typically varies between 2,500 PLN and 4,000 PLN. This consists of the medical checkup (200 PLN), driving school course (2,000-- 3,000 PLN), state exam charges (200 PLN for theory and practice integrated), and the final card issuance cost (100 PLN).
3. What occurs if I get caught using a fake driving license?
Using a forged document is a serious criminal offense under Polish law. According to Article 270 of the Polish Penal Code, producing or utilizing a falsified file can cause a fine, constraint of liberty, or jail time ranging from 3 months approximately 5 years.
4. The length of time does the entire legal process take?
Typically, completing the medical check, theory classes, practical driving hours, and passing both exams takes between 2 to 4 months, depending upon your schedule and the waiting times at your regional WORD center.
